Transaction 86fab9134cc0aaf1f16266fad997c7c2d0f1d15cd41f816cf62a154b37a0c03e

11 Input
2 Outputs
  • 86fab9134cc0aaf1f16266fad997c7c2d0f1d15cd41f816cf62a154b37a0c03e:0
  • value  52638
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• 86fab9134cc0aaf1f16266fad997c7c2d0f1d15cd41f816cf62a154b37a0c03e:1
  • value  5203336
    address  1MQatft7W4VpveHB43xLopbmFZuSmA3Vdv